Queenie's Compatibility:
Dogs - Meet & Greet
Cats - Not a good fit
Kids - Queenie's most comfortable with grown-ups

Say hello to Queenie, the funniest girl in the building. She's terrified of spray cheese, she'll run through every trick she knows for a single marshmallow, and she becomes an absolute professional the second a bathtub is involved. She's five, her personality is the size of Indiana, and once she decides you're her person, that's it. You're hers.

Queenie's love is the quiet, loyal kind. She's not going to fling herself at you the moment you walk in the door. She's more of an "I'll settle in nearby and keep you company on my own terms" kind of girl, and there's something really special about a dog who chooses you. She's housebroken, and she'd love to be somebody's one and only in a calm, cozy home.
